Looking through an early Secret Service deposition by Buell Wesley Frazier in preparation for a post to my thread on Oswald's first day at the TSBD I noticed the most bizarre misspelling of his sister Linnie [Mae] Randle's name. it's a two page document linked here: Below I've highlighted the real problem: Wesley, presumably, made and initialed one correction in the same paragraph but left the absurd misspelling uncorrected, yet approves his statement of two pages and signs it! I know Wes had grammar issues, and the statement is obviously prepared, but I simply refuse to accept he would not spot such misspelling. Anyone?

As per LMR's affidavit she knew how to spell her own name, no surprises here, but something I hadn't noticed before was that Frazier's first day affidavit doesn't mention his sister at all (no need to spell her name) and same goes for his March FBI statement. That's contrary to the Secret Service report.
What I did notice RE the March FBI reports, that I missed previously, is that many of the witnesses say they have read "this" page, and even two others, but only one is shown in the exhibit and you wouldn't know there were more when you go through the statement unless it was specifically mentioned. This is but one example (FBI page #12):
There is only one conclusion, as the page numbers are consecutive: this shit was originally edited by the FBI! In the cover letter Hoover notes that some "stuff" had to be removed due to concerns RE certain peoples addresses. So two pages out of three were addresses???
Looks like you can add CE 1381 to your endless list of suppressed evidence!
In summary, to me the misspelled name in the Frazier statement looks like "phonetic" spelling to me. May have been a late addition to a draft Wes "approved". Legally you can't mess with a signed document but corrections like "House"/W.F. is also seen in his November 22 affidavit, initialed in exactly the same way. Anyway, doesn't really explain why he didn't fix his sister's name while he was at it doing the other correction....
